Chess is going through massive changes. Over the last 30 years, chess and computers have become entwined. And that's causing a clash between new technology and a centuries-old game. The commentators knew that the game was over the second a move was made. But it took the players themselves a few minutes to know for sure. That's because the commentators use computers that calculate what one move means for all the next moves.
